Building History

The San Francisco Office of Skidmore, Owings and Merrill (SOM) designed this second headquarters in San Francisco for the Federal Reserve Bank of San Francisco. The building was designed while Edward Charles "Chuck" Bassett (1921-1999) was the chief designer within the SOM San Francisco Office.

Building Notes

This was one of 12 regional branches of the Federal Reserve Bank; it, in turn, had its own branches in the West covering a large territory; offices in 2008 were located in Portland, OR, Los Angeles, CA, Salt Lake City, UT, Renton, WA, and Phoenix, AZ. Tel: (415) 974-2000 (2008);
